Private Schools Registration Update
Due to passage of Senate Bill 26 during the 2011 Legislative session there is no longer a process for private prek-12 schools to register with the Oregon Department of Education. Although private prek-12 schools no longer register, the process for
Child Care Licensing
remains in effect.

Private Schools and Special Education
Parentally Placed Private School Students
Under the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(IDEA) some special education and related services may be available for children with disabilities enrolled by parents in nonprofit private elementary and secondary schools. District and ECSE Placed Private School Students
Oregon public school districts and Early Childhood Special Education (ECSE) programs may place children in, or refer children to, private schools or private preschools as a means of providing special education and related services. Private schools providing these services must meet specific state public education standards.
